What skills and experience we're looking for
We are seeking to appoint an enthusiastic, committed and engaging science teacher to join our fantastic school. The successful candidate will work within an ambitious, vibrant and high performing department to instil a love of science in all students. The department runs multiple A-Level classes in each of Biology, Chemistry, Physics and Environmental Science, and an ability to teach one of those to A-Level would be expected of the successful candidate. The department achieved a value-added score of +0.7 at GCSE last year, significantly above national average, plus excellent A-Level outcomes and has a strong track record of large numbers of students going on to study science related courses at university.

Educating approximately 1200 students, The Bishop’s Stortford High School provides a single-sex education for boys in Years 7 to 11 and has a large co-educational sixth form, of which a third are female students. The school prides itself on being an academic school built on traditional principles and high standards, within a Christian ethos, which is reflected in excellent results. In March 2017 Ofsted judged the school to be Outstanding in every category with their report, highlighting the many strengths and the great opportunities provided.
